Item 17, Additional Disclosure. In recognition of the restrictions contained in Section 13.1-564 of the Virginia Retail Franchising Act, the Franchise Disclosure Document for Franchisor for use in the Commonwealth of Virginia shall be amended as follows:

"Pursuant to Section 13.1-564 of the Virginia Retail Franchising Act, it is unlawful for a franchisor to cancel a franchise without reasonable cause. If any ground for default or termination stated in the franchise agreement does not constitute "reasonable cause," as that term may be defined in the Virginia Retail Franchising Act or the laws of Virginia, that provision may not be enforceable."

According to Kitchen Solvers' 2025 Franchise Disclosure Document, an addendum addresses the Virginia Retail Franchising Act. Specifically, Section 13.1-564 of the Virginia Retail Franchising Act is referenced concerning restrictions on franchise cancellation.

This section states that it is unlawful for Kitchen Solvers to cancel a franchise without reasonable cause. The addendum clarifies that if any grounds for default or termination stated in the franchise agreement do not constitute "reasonable cause" as defined in the Virginia Retail Franchising Act or the laws of Virginia, that provision may not be enforceable.

For a prospective Kitchen Solvers franchisee in Virginia, this addendum provides an additional layer of protection. It ensures that the franchise agreement adheres to Virginia law regarding what constitutes reasonable cause for cancellation, preventing Kitchen Solvers from enforcing termination clauses that do not meet the state's legal standards. This could be a significant benefit, offering more security and recourse in the event of a dispute over termination.
